The Importance of Space Planning and Layout
Space planning is the art of maximizing the usability and visual appeal of a space. Before even thinking about furniture, you should start by assessing the existing structure and identifying its strengths and weaknesses. The best way to make the best of a room is to take the measurements of the available space, including doors, windows, and architectural elements like columns or built-in elements. Think about the flow of traffic. Think about how people will move through the space. The objective is to make sure your space feels open and inviting. Another thing to consider is the furniture placement. Avoid overcrowding the room. Instead, choose a few statement pieces and carefully arrange them to create balance and harmony. If you have a small space, you should consider multi-functional furniture like a sofa bed. It helps solve your space constraints.

Living Room Ideas: Creating a Cozy Haven
The living room is often the heart of the home, a place for relaxation, entertainment, and connection. Start by considering the focal point of the space. It could be a fireplace, a large window, or a statement piece of artwork. Arrange the furniture around this focal point to create a sense of harmony. A large, comfortable sofa is essential. Add some accent chairs, ottomans, and coffee tables. Next, think about the color palettes. Start by selecting the dominant color and choosing some complementary colors. A neutral palette with pops of color can provide a versatile base that you can customize with accents. When you are done with the colors, itâs time to move on to the lighting. Think about layering different types of light, like ambient, task, and accent. Soft, ambient lighting from floor lamps and table lamps can create a welcoming atmosphere. Now, letâs bring in some home decor. Add pillows, throws, artwork, and plants to make the room feel personal and lived-in. Incorporating a mix of texturesâthink a soft rug, textured cushions, and wooden elementsâwill add depth and visual interest. Remember, your goal is to design a room that feels not only comfortable but also reflects your personality. The living room is where your personality is most expressed.

Kitchen Design: Functionality and Style
The kitchen is the hub of the home. Here is where we spend a great deal of time. Start by optimizing the layout for functionality. Ensure that the layout allows for easy movement and efficient workflow. Consider the âwork triangleâ (the space between the sink, stove, and refrigerator) to make your space comfortable. Make sure to maximize the available space. Now let's explore the style. Whether you are leaning towards modern interior design or a rustic farmhouse, the style should complement your home. Select the materials for your cabinets, countertops, and backsplash that reflect your style. The finishes and colors can have a huge effect on the overall look of the kitchen. Consider the lighting in the kitchen. Make sure there is enough task lighting over the work surfaces. Add pendant lights over the island or the dining area to add style. Donât forget about the appliances and accessories. Select appliances that are both functional and complement your design aesthetic. Add some decorative elements like a vase, or some plants. Bathroom Design: Creating a Spa-Like Experience
The bathroom should be a place of relaxation and rejuvenation. First, consider the layout of the bathroom. Make sure you have enough space for the toilet, the shower, and the sink. If you have a small bathroom, consider a walk-in shower. Think about the vanity and the storage options. You may opt for a floating vanity to make the space feel more open. Now, think about the materials. Choose the materials for the flooring, the walls, and the shower. Marble, porcelain, and ceramic tiles can be very elegant choices. Letâs talk about the lighting. Add a combination of overhead lights, vanity lights, and accent lights to make a soothing environment. Now, letâs talk about the home decor. Choose some plants and accessories. A soft, fluffy rug, some candles, and some decorative soaps can make the space feel luxurious. This can transform your bathroom into a spa.

Avoiding Common Mistakes in Home Decor
- Poor Planning: Without a plan, you might buy things that donât fit or donât work in the space. Measure everything before you purchase anything.
- Overcrowding: Avoid cluttering the room. Focus on functionality.
- Ignoring the Scale: Furniture should be in proportion to the size of the room.
- Poor Lighting: Lighting can make or break the space. It helps set the mood.
- Lack of Personalization: Adding your own personality to your design space can make the space more inviting.
